#実現したいこと
rails s
の後に
? /home/vagrant/.rbenv/versions/2.5.1/lib/ruby/gems/2.5.0/bundler/gems/webpacker-bb132d591da3/lib/webpacker/dev_server_proxy.rb:22
というメッセージを表示させたくない
#現状
rails s
をすると
こうなります。
application.html.erbは表示されますが、表示したいvue絡みの動きは無視されています。
[vagrant@localhost salonreserve]$ rails s => Booting Puma => Rails 5.2.1 application starting in development => Run `rails server -h` for more startup options Puma starting in single mode... * Version 3.12.0 (ruby 2.5.1-p57), codename: Llamas in Pajamas * Min threads: 5, max threads: 5 * Environment: development * Listening on tcp://0.0.0.0:3000 Use Ctrl-C to stop Started GET "/" for 10.0.2.2 at 2018-11-02 14:26:21 +0000 (6.2ms) SET NAMES utf8, @@SESSION.sql_mode = CONCAT(CONCAT(@@sql_mode, ',STRICT_ALL_TABLES'), ',NO_AUTO_VALUE_ON_ZERO'), @@SESSION.sql_auto_is_null = 0, @@SESSION.wait_timeout = 2147483 ? /home/vagrant/.rbenv/versions/2.5.1/lib/ruby/gems/2.5.0/bundler/gems/webpacker-bb132d591da3/lib/webpacker/dev_server_proxy.rb:22 # ↑これは一体…? Processing by TopController#index as HTML Rendering html template within layouts/application Rendered html template within layouts/application (0.0ms) [Webpacker] Compiling… [Webpacker] Compilation failed: # 以下もエラーメッセージですが、これはVuetifyとnode_modules絡みで別問題?みたいなので、割愛します。
Vagrantfileの中身
Vagrant.configure("2") do |config| # コメントになっているところやファイルパスは省略 config.vm.network "forwarded_port", guest: 3000, host: 3000, host_ip: "127.0.0.1" config.vm.network "private_network", ip: "192.168.33.10" end
#試したこと
ruby
1# config/environment/deveropment.rb 2 3config.file_watcher = ActiveSupport::FileUpdateChecker #EventedFileUpdateCheckerから変更 4 5config.web_console.whitelisted_ips = '0.0.0.0/0' #追加
ruby
1# webpacker.yml 2dev_server: 3 https: false 4 host: 0.0.0.0 #localhostから左記に変更 5 port: 3035 6 public: localhost:3035 7 hmr: false
#環境
Vagrant 2.2.0
Rails 5.2.1
Ruby 2.5.1
Bundler 1.17.1
node v10.12.0
webpacker 4.0.0.pre.3
Yarn 1.10.1
魔境に片足を突っ込んでしまった感がありますが、何かご存知な方がいらっしゃれば解答のほど、よろしくお願いいたします。
あなたの回答
tips
プレビュー